Transaction e63b3885c3717033fea83355eb90dcc112f104f90382a4478c2a8f7c58749043

1 Input
2 Outputs
  • e63b3885c3717033fea83355eb90dcc112f104f90382a4478c2a8f7c58749043:0
  • value  466000
    address  3QtDGy92rVTuk4P6T5TFDmBSJwsGmZ9wjf
  • e63b3885c3717033fea83355eb90dcc112f104f90382a4478c2a8f7c58749043:1
  • value  31458888
    address  167EhtBQSsTAPNcJrkFpHW6a4k7XER6uHR